About the Role
As our Sustainable Packaging Assistant you will manage, analyse and report on environmental and packaging data across all product lines, ensuring compliance with UK, Irish and global legislation, support packaging reduction initiatives and maintain accurate data to deliver our sustainability goals.
* Update and maintain database records for packaging types, materials, weights and recycled content across existing and new product ranges.
* Monitor and maintain compliance data for UK Packaging Legislations, WEEE, Battery reporting (UK & Ireland) and global supplier Sedex environmental audits.
* Analyse data to identify non‑compliant or high‑impact problem lines.
* Support Buying Category Managers and sales teams to drive supplier‑level packaging reductions.
* Create and track KPIs for packaging reduction, waste, recycling and utilities in alignment with ISO 14001 standards.
* Sourcing and maintaining embodied emission data required for UK CBAM (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ism) reporting.
* Coordinate with the design studio on OPRL (On‑Pack Recycling Label) artwork requirements and maintain the FSC database for certified products.
